199 Why the buzz around Magnesium? Understanding magnesium with Magnesium Lotion Shop Owners Mike and Tiffany29 Aug 202400:30:37

Today's episode is all about understanding magnesium, where it comes from, why we need it, what the dosing is, and how critical this mineral is for pregnancy.

Magnesium Lotion Shop started with Tiffany having restless legs during pregnancy and postpartum, not knowing until much later it was because of a magnesium deficiency. Tiffany created a DIY version of lotion that worked, and shared it on her blog. Readers kept asking her to make them some. So she worked to develop a smooth, creamy, non-greasy formula. Today Magnesium Lotion Shop has two formulas - ORIGINAL (unscented) and SLEEP (lavender w/melatonin) - and both are plant-based, and non-toxic.

3 Key takeaways from the podcast that listeners will learn today:

  • Magnesium is used by over 400 processes in the body, including healthy sleep cycles, blood circulation, muscle cramps, anxiety, regulating moods

  • Over ⅔ of population is deficient in magnesium. Even more important in pregnancy and post-partum when baby gets first dibs on nutrients

  • Topical magnesium avoids digestive distress/discomfort. Achieving healthy levels of magnesium requires consistent daily use

185 FREE Egg Freezing with Cofertility founder Lauren Makler17 Nov 202301:10:22

While Lauren was pitching Uber Health to their executive team, she felt a sharp, irregular pain in her stomach. With testing and a diagnostic surgery, she was diagnosed with an incredibly rare disease and was told she may not be able to have a biological child. As you can imagine, her first questions were: how do I navigate this disease? But also, how will I build a family some day?  Because so little is known about this disease, it was unclear if she could pursue egg-freezing, so she started looking into donation  and what stuck out to her was how antiquated and, for a lack of a better word, “icky” the traditional system felt. 

While, ultimately, she was very fortunate to have her sister freeze her eggs and donate them to her to potentially use later, and was able to conceive her baby girl unassisted, she never stopped thinking about egg donation. I spent months thinking about the costly, and emotionally and physically taxing feats people go through to build a family, and couldn’t believe no one has been talking about this and yet, egg donation is at the crux of so many other pieces of the industry. It’s an essential part of LGBTQ+ family planning, it goes hand in hand with egg-freezing, and it’s part of the process for many couples who go through infertility. 

That’s why in 2022, she founded Cofertility, to reshape fertility preservation and third-party reproduction so it’s more accessible, human and community-driven. The company offers a destigmatized, scalable approach to egg donation, which reshapes the cost structure of egg-freezing by matching women who want to freeze their eggs with families who could not otherwise conceive and by donating half, women can freeze their eggs for free. Since their launch last fall, tens of thousands of people have applied to be a part of their egg-freezing programs, and they have activated hundreds of donors. They’ve also taken a firm stance against the historical, predatory practices that involve cash compensation and failing to provide fertility education for the donor’s own reproductive future. In the egg-sharing model, which is what their Split program offers, there is a focus on shared outcomes rather than financial gain. All members get access to their online community, where people talk openly about their egg-freezing experience and support one another through it in real time and they welcome all intended parents — single or coupled, regardless of what brought them here — and support them with compassion and respect for whatever path is best for them.

65 Modern Fertility CEO Afton Vechery17 Dec 202000:48:56

Meet Afton Vechery. She is the CEO of Modern Fertility and she is taking on women’s health globally at 31 years old. Afton lives in San Francisco with her fiancé Zach and her new puppy. She loves biking throughout the city and her favorite restaurant is Salumeria. Afton was featured in 30 under 30 and 40 under 40 after raising 22 million in private equity to build this company. Afton studied neuroscience at Wake Forest University in North Carolina before heading off to work in NYC for a private equity healthcare fund in their women’s health division. From their she gained momentum in an autism start up and then at 23&Me. While at 23&Me she became curious about her own fertility. That is when her doctor said, “No, I am not going to order these fertility tests for you.” You see she wasn’t trying to get pregnant so her provider dismissed her proactive curiosity. So she did what all rational women do….she did it anyway. And, she was ultra surprised when she got a bill for $1500. Afton then set out to build a company where women would proactively learn about their fertility and it would be affordable. Today, your personal fertility test with Modern Fertility costs just $159 and you can use your FSA or HSA to pay for it. That is 10% of the out of pocket cost if your provider writes a prescription for you and sends you to a lab. A quick finger prick from the comfort of your own home begins your awareness and planning journey with Modern Fertility. Tune in to hear the full story of how Modern Fertility was birthed, what they are doing for the LGBTQIA+ community and what in the world AMH is and what it means for your fertility and egg quality.

57 Brook Machin Last Minute Swap to Homebirth due to COVID restrictions08 Oct 202001:11:54

In late 2019 when Brook found out she was pregnant, she had to decide where to birth since her trusted birthing center had closed. Little did she know that the coronavirus was about to impact this decision. Brook chose a hospital birth with her favorite midwives and hired a doula. As the pandemic spread, Brook made the secret decision with her husband to switch to a home birth. She received parallel care throughout her pregnancy with both the hospital and homebirth midwives.

About a week before the birth, Brook experienced classic prodromal labor that would start every night and last until about 2 am before she would be able to go back to sleep. On the day of labor, she knew it was different when she couldn’t go back to sleep and she had a bowel movement at 3 am.

Brook had a long labor for a second baby laboring all through the night and the next day. After she put her older son to bed that evening surges increased to 4-5 minutes apart. Her midwife described her tension ring when she got to 5-6 cm dilated and she was holding on to her previous birth experience. Brook had to let go.

Brook labored in and out of the tub and her water was still intact just before pushing. She pushed for almost 4 hours before her son was born at 1:23 am. Her midwife and doula gave her permission to let go and get primal and roar her baby out. And that is exactly what she did. Brook achieved a beautiful homebirth despite the pandemic in the comfort of her own home surrounded by her family and support team.
